增加删除行
//增加一行
function add_row(obj,data,cell){
var tr=obj.insertRow();
var td;
for(var i=0;i<cell.length;i++){
td=tr.insertCell();
td.innerHTML=cell[i](data);
}
}
//调用方法
function add_item(){
var init_item={budget_quarter:'1',budget_month:'1',amount:''};
var obj=document.getElementById("budget_items");
add_row(obj,init_item,budget_cell);
}
//单元格定义
var budget_cell=[
function(value){
return "<select name='budget_quarter' onchange='changeMonth(this)'>"+
optstr(kv_quarter,value.budget_quarter)+
"</select>";},
function(value){
return "<select name='budget_month'>"+
opt_month(value.budget_quarter,value.budget_month)+
"</select>月";},
function(value){
return "<input type=text name='amount' style='text-align:right;padding:1px;' value='"+value.amount+"' onchange='sum_amount()'/>元";},
function(value){
return "<a href='javascript:void(0)' onclick='del_item(this)'>删除</a>";}
];
//删除一条
function del_item(obj){
var tr=obj.parentElement.parentElement;
var tb1=tr.parentElement;
tb1.removeChild(tr);
}
效果:
- 大小: 18.5 KB
分享到:
相关推荐
在探讨“javascript表格操作”的知识点时,我们主要聚焦于如何利用JavaScript来动态地操作HTML中的表格元素,包括但不限于创建、删除行或单元格,以及进行数据的排序和汇总。以下是对这一主题的深入解析。 ### 动态...
通过以上步骤,你可以实现一个基本的基于DOM的JavaScript表格数据操作系统。这个系统可以适应各种数据管理需求,为用户提供直观的界面和流畅的操作体验。在实际项目中,可能还需要处理更复杂的交互逻辑,如表单验证...
在探讨“javascript表格操作”这一主题时,我们深入解析如何使用JavaScript来动态地创建、修改和操作HTML表格。以下是从给定的代码片段中提取的关键知识点: ### 动态插入行与删除行 #### 插入行:`insertRow()` -...
包括js动态表格的操作。数据的复制
本篇内容主要介绍了使用JavaScript进行表格操作的方法,包括创建表格、删除行与单元格、选取表格元素以及处理表格事件等。这些技术对于开发动态网页或应用程序来说是非常有用的。通过这些技术,可以实现更加灵活的...
JavaScript表格操作是Web开发中的重要组成部分,特别是在构建交互式用户界面时。HTML表格提供了一种组织数据的标准方式,而JavaScript则赋予了这些表格动态性和交互性。在这个话题中,我们将深入探讨如何使用...
在JavaScript编程中,操作表格是一项常见的任务,尤其是在网页交互和数据展示方面。...通过实践和查阅相关资源,你可以进一步提升在JavaScript表格操作方面的技能。记住,持续学习和实践是成为IT行业大师的关键。
在JavaScript中,表格操作是网页动态交互的重要组成部分。本文将详细介绍如何使用JavaScript来操作HTML表格,包括创建、删除表格行和单元格以及设置属性。 1. **插入行和单元格** - `insertRow()`函数用于在表格...
在JavaScript(简称JS)中,表格操作是网页动态交互中常见的功能,主要用于处理HTML中的`<table>`元素。本教程将深入探讨如何使用JS实现表格的增、删、改操作,帮助你创建更加灵活和交互性强的数据展示界面。 首先...
Javascript 表格操作实现代码 Javascript 是一种广泛应用于 Web 开发的脚本语言,它可以用来实现网页的交互效果和动态更新。在本文中,我们将通过实例代码来介绍如何使用 Javascript 实现表格操作,包括获取表格值...
js操作表格 实例 js操作表格 实例 js操作表格 实例
在JavaScript中,动态操作表格是一项常见的任务,尤其在构建数据驱动的Web应用时。下面将详细探讨这个主题,包括如何添加、删除、选择表格以及兼容性问题。 首先,让我们从添加表格开始。在HTML中,表格由`<table>`...
在描述中提到的富文本编辑器集成了表格操作功能,这使得用户可以在编辑区域内创建和编辑表格,这对于数据展示和组织信息非常有用。表格操作通常包括以下方面: 1. **创建表格**:用户可以通过点击编辑器菜单中的...
在JavaScript编程中,表格是一种常见的数据展示方式,用于呈现结构化的信息。在“Javascript表格高级...记住,实践是检验理论的最好方式,所以动手尝试这些操作,将有助于加深理解和掌握JavaScript表格操作的核心概念。
在IT行业中,JavaScript(简称JS)通常用于网页前端交互,但通过特定的库和API,我们也能使用JS来操作Microsoft Word文档,包括在Word中创建和编辑表格。本篇文章将详细探讨如何使用JS来实现这一功能,以及相关的...
3. **表格操作**: - **创建新行**:要向表格添加行,首先需要创建一个新的`<tr>`元素,然后创建`<td>`元素并设置其内容。最后,将这些元素添加到表格的`<tbody>`标签内。 - **删除行**:通过获取行的引用(例如,...
"纯js电子表格操作"这个主题涉及到使用JavaScript处理电子表格数据,如读取、解析、修改和生成Excel文件。下面将详细探讨相关的知识点。 1. **js-xlsx库**: js-xlsx是JavaScript的一个开源库,专门用于处理Excel...
<title>JS 表格操作 ()">添加行 ()">删除选中行 ()">排序 姓名 年龄 城市 <script src="table_operations.js"> ``` 接下来,我们需要在`table_operations.js`文件中编写JavaScript代码...
9. **数据绑定**:更高级的实现可能涉及到数据绑定,如使用MVVM框架(如Vue.js或React.js),这样可以将数据与视图分离,实现更高效且易于维护的表格操作。 10. **兼容性考虑**:在编写JavaScript代码时,要确保其...